The EarthStone Grill Cleaning Block is seriously a game-changer for grill lovers like myself. This thing easily tackles all that nasty grease and grime on the grates, leaving them squeaky clean for the next cookout. Plus, that handy handle makes it a breeze to use.
I liked the fact that I had an alternative to cleaning the barbecue grill with something other than a wire brush. Wire brushes are potentially dangerous and can unknowingly leave wire strands on the food you barbecue. This can lead into an emergency I wasn't planning on. So this brush is a great alternative and effectively cleans the grill well.
this is by far my favorite grill brush. I love how well it cleans the grates. there is no metal pieces chip off like the other grill brushes. there is 1 huge down fall being it is a stone it does make a littlw bit of a mess but I would say take a wet paper towel and wipe the grates or blow it off and it will come right off. another down side is do not leave it in the rain, it gets soaked up in the stone and then you can not use it until it dries out again. plus side you can buy refills for it and its decently cheap.
I always used metal grill brushes but out of safety concerns with the bristles getting into food, wanted to try something else. This worked great and got the grill clean. The heat seems like it will wear it down eventually, unlike a metal grill brush, but at the price point it is a good solution
Great at cleaning but you will only get one use out of it. It wears down fast After cleaning one grill which took less than 4 minutes the stone was worn down to the handle. I thought this would be a better alternative to a wire brush grill cleaner. Although a wire brush grill cleaner is good I seen a news report that a woman got a bristle stuck in her throat that required surgery to remove after eating a burger she made on the grill she just cleaned. looks like I am going to go back to the scrubber pad type of grill cleaner. the only problem with that is you can't use that type of grill cleaner on a hot grill.
Pieces of this product broke away when trying to clean the grill.. would not recommend.
Very unsatisfied after reading all the reviews. Block just falls right out of the handle. Hard to get in between the grates and it disintegrated as you used it so unless you wipe the grated down or hose them off I'm sure you're eating a powder left behind from the block.
I was excited to use it because I don't feel safe with using the wire brush to clean the grill because of in the past finding metal bristles in my cook food. The ceramic brick cleaner does not clean the grill it just sheds the ceramic on the grill and leaves dust and ceramic bits on the grill so I will not use it because I don't want that in my food.
